Output d93eab8c295b7e11723541af33b66dc75f06102f2d6f10024c8534de58dcb68d:0

value
240941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6b471cf1f8332623aaab7ef5040c790368a61cf OP_EQUAL
address
3QBUKF1SrKbpZBgyVWvccCbZ6ZGxgeJbP5
transaction
d93eab8c295b7e11723541af33b66dc75f06102f2d6f10024c8534de58dcb68d
confirmations
144253
spent
true